Conversion help

For your conveniance, we have listed the conversion syntaxes for 1419897659 timestamp to serveral of the most popular programming lanugages below.

PHP
date('Y-m-d H:i:s', 1419897659);
MySQL
select from_unixtime(1419897659);
JavaScript
new Date(1419897659*1000).toString();
C++
time_t epch = 1419897659;
printf("%i -> %s", epch, asctime(gmtime(&epch))); (time.h);
C#
String.Format("{0:d/M/yyyy HH:mm:ss}", new System.DateTime(1970, 1,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0).AddSeconds(1419897659));
Java
new SimpleDateFormat("MM/dd/yyyy HH:mm:ss").format(new Date(1419897659 * 1000L))
Ruby
require 'date'
DateTime.strptime("1419897659",'%s')
